I was looking into how major companies are adapting their payment systems and found some interesting material about payment trends. It seems that there's a significant focus on real-time payment infrastructure and the continued rise of digital wallets. The article also highlights how critical data security and AI integration are becoming for businesses. One particular aspect mentioned is the increasing demand for personalization in payments. Apparently, companies are recalibrating their processes to align with consumer preferences, trying to make transactions more seamless and tailored. It appears many corporations are indeed moving towards more integrated payment solutions that leverage AI for efficiency and security. The discussion around personalization is quite relevant, as consumer expectations for tailored experiences are continually rising. Businesses are looking to optimize operational efficiency by offering diverse payment options, which often includes expanding beyond traditional methods. This shift is reportedly driven by the goal of enhancing customer acquisition and retention in a fiercely competitive market.
